Asus MeMO Pad ME170C — 3.8V Li-Polymer Replacement Battery (C11P1327)

This is a 3.8V 3900mAh Li-Polymer battery for the Asus MeMO Pad ME170C 7-inch Android tablet. It fits the ME170C, Fonepad 7" Dual SIM phablet, and K012 variants that share the same cell footprint and connector. Use the OEM part number C11P1327 or 0B200-00950000 to confirm fitment before ordering.

  • ME170C and K012 platform fit: These models share the same 3.8V single-cell Li-Polymer architecture, connector pinout, and BMS handshake protocol — which is why one cell covers both the standard MeMO Pad and the Fonepad dual-SIM variant without modification.
  • Bench tested on actual hardware: We cycled this cell on the ME170C mainboard and confirmed the BMS initialised correctly, charge termination triggered at 4.35V, and the protection circuit responded to overcurrent within spec.
  • Fuel gauge recalibration after swap: After fitting this battery, run one full discharge to automatic shutoff, then charge uninterrupted to 100%. This resets the fuel gauge IC calibration against the new cell and clears the inaccurate percentage readings that appear immediately after a replacement.

Why the ME170C shuts down at 15–25% remaining

The fuel gauge IC on the ME170C is calibrated against the original cell's internal resistance profile. When a new cell is installed, the IC does not yet know where the actual voltage cliff sits. Under combined display and Wi-Fi load, the cell voltage drops faster than the gauge predicts, and the protection circuit cuts power before the displayed percentage reaches zero. One full discharge-to-shutoff cycle followed by an uninterrupted charge to 100% resets this mapping and resolves the early shutdown.

Fast charging unavailable on the ME170C after battery replacement

The ME170C charge IC negotiates charge rate based on a completed charge handshake with the battery BMS. On a fresh cell, this negotiation has not yet occurred, so the charger defaults to standard rate on the first cycle. After one full accepted charge cycle at standard rate, the IC recognises the cell and fast charge becomes available through supported chargers. If it still does not activate after two full cycles, check that the original Asus charger is in use — third-party adapters often lack the voltage negotiation signal the charge IC expects.

Frequently Asked Questions

My ME170C shows 40% battery then just turns off — is the new battery faulty?

The battery is not faulty. The fuel gauge IC is still calibrated to the old cell's resistance profile, so it cannot predict the voltage cliff accurately under real load. Run one complete discharge to automatic shutoff, then charge uninterrupted to 100% — this recalibrates the IC against the new cell. After that cycle, unexpected shutoffs at mid-percentage typically stop.

The battery percentage on my ME170C is dropping faster than it should from a full charge — what's wrong?

This is fuel gauge drift caused by the IC reading a new cell through a calibration map built for the degraded original. The percentage is inaccurate, not the capacity. Complete one full discharge-to-shutoff cycle followed by a single uninterrupted charge to 100%. That one cycle resets the gauge reference points and the drop rate will normalise.

My ME170C feels warm on the back while charging after I swapped the battery — should I be concerned?

Mild warmth during the first two or three charge cycles is normal. The charge IC on the ME170C runs a conditioning pass on a new cell, which draws slightly more current than a routine top-up on an aged cell. If the tablet becomes hot to the touch or the warmth persists beyond the third full cycle, check that the connector is fully seated flat against the board — a partially seated connector increases resistance at the contact point and generates heat.
